Klaviyo vs Mailchimp in 2026: Ecommerce Email Automation Compared

A comparison of Klaviyo and Mailchimp for ecommerce email automation in 2026. Covers Shopify integration depth, predictive analytics, pricing at 5K-100K subscribers, and revenue attribution data from a 90-day test.

The Bottom Line: Choose Klaviyo for Shopify-centric ecommerce with predictive analytics. Choose Mailchimp for all-in-one marketing at lower cost across industries.

Introduction

Klaviyo and Mailchimp are two of the most popular email marketing platforms, but they serve different audiences. Klaviyo is purpose-built for ecommerce, with deep Shopify, WooCommerce, and BigCommerce integrations and predictive analytics per subscriber. Mailchimp is an all-in-one marketing platform with broader features (landing pages, social ads, surveys) serving businesses across all industries. As of April 2026, Klaviyo powers over 100,000 ecommerce brands, while Mailchimp serves over 12 million users.

Ecommerce Automation

Klaviyo provides pre-built ecommerce flows that launch within minutes of Shopify connection: abandoned cart (triggered by checkout start without completion), browse abandonment (triggered by product views without cart add), post-purchase cross-sell (triggered by order delivery), and winback (triggered by inactivity threshold). Each flow includes predictive send-time optimization that analyzes individual subscriber open patterns.

Mailchimp provides Customer Journeys with ecommerce triggers for abandoned cart, order confirmation, and post-purchase follow-up. The flows are functional but less granular than Klaviyo's behavioral triggers. Mailchimp's ecommerce automations operate on batch-processed segments rather than real-time events.

Pricing by Subscriber Count

Subscribers Klaviyo Mailchimp Standard Difference
1,000 $30/month $26.50/month Klaviyo +13%
5,000 $100/month $75/month Klaviyo +33%
25,000 $400/month $270/month Klaviyo +48%
50,000 $720/month $350/month Klaviyo +106%
100,000 $1,380/month $700/month Klaviyo +97%

Klaviyo is consistently more expensive, with the gap widening at scale. At 50,000 contacts, Klaviyo costs 106% more than Mailchimp.

Editor's Note: We ran a 90-day comparison for a Shopify store with 35,000 subscribers. Klaviyo ($500/month) generated $18,200 in attributed email revenue; Mailchimp Standard ($300/month) generated $14,600. The $200/month price difference was offset by $3,600/month in additional revenue. Klaviyo's predictive send timing and browse abandonment flows drove the difference. For non-Shopify businesses or those with simple email needs, Mailchimp's lower cost and broader feature set is the better choice.

What does the Resend free tier include in 2026?

As of July 2026, the Resend free tier includes 3,000 emails/month, 100 emails/day, one verified domain, 30-day email log retention, and basic webhooks. It is intended for development, testing, and very small production sends; teams typically upgrade to the $20/month Pro plan (50,000 emails/month, multiple domains, audiences) once they exceed the 100-emails/day cap. The next step up is Scale at $90/month (100,000 emails, dedicated IP available). Resend's appeal is developer experience — React email templates and modern SDKs — rather than the free tier being the largest in the category.

What's the difference between Resend, SendGrid, and Postmark?

Resend is a React-template developer-first email API from 2023 with 3,000 free emails/month and $20/month for 50K. SendGrid is the high-scale market leader from 2009 (Twilio) with marketing plus transactional from $19.95/month. Postmark is the deliverability specialist from 2010 (ActiveCampaign) for transactional-only at $15/month for 10K.
